The Ladybug Festival is a celebration of women in music taking place annually in both Wilmington, and Milford, Delaware. Started in 2012 by Gable Music Ventures, the idea was to offer an alternative to the Firefly Music Festival that was focused on local independent artists, and free for the community to attend. Michael and Debbie Schwartz, owners of the popular Shops and Lofts at 2nd & LOMA, engaged the company to throw a live music block party for their tenants shortly after Firefly was announced. Gable used the timing of the request to put on the first ever “Ladybug Festival”, featuring an all-female lineup of artists local to the Wilmington/Philadelphia music scene. From 2012 through 2017 the event grew to be one of the most popular in Wilmington, with attendance doubling every year. At the 2017 event, the Mayor of Wilmington made a Mayoral Proclamation of Ladybug Day! As the event has grown, Gable Music Ventures has become even more inspired to make an impact for women in the music industry. The Ladybug Festival not only exclusively hires female or female-identifying fronted bands, but we do our best to hire as many women as we can for available positions on festival staff.
